    Weed Whacker and oil
    I forgot that my Toro 4 cycle weed whacker takes regular gas. I accidentally, put gas in the whacker mixed with oil. The engine started with no problems however after about 5 minutes it started to run roughly and when I tried to press on the level to turn the whacker it stalls. After realizing what I had done, I changed the gas. Now the whacker runs, however, it stalls every time I press on the lever to get the whacker working. My question to you is: Can I clean the engine out and have I messed up the engine completely?

    Remove the plug.
    Spray carb cleaner in the plug hole.
    Put rag over hole.
    Crank until you get the muck out.
    Put in new plug.

    Start. Spray the air horn.

    BtW: Carb cleaner can be used as starting fluid. Never use starting fluid in a small engine.
